This document discusses natural sources of water and various methods to purify water, including filtration, boiling, chlorination, and distillation. Filtration removes solid particles but not microorganisms or dissolved substances. Boiling kills microorganisms but does not remove other impurities. Chlorination kills microorganisms and is used for large quantities of water but too much chlorine is unhealthy. Distillation produces pure water free of all impurities through the boiling and condensation process.
